Notes

Research across these three metropolitan areas reveals distinct regional manufacturing characteristics. The Boston/Massachusetts region shows a strong concentration of companies serving medical device, aerospace, and defense sectors, with several firms maintaining decades-long histories and specialized cleanroom capabilities. The Detroit metro area, as expected, demonstrates deep automotive industry ties with IATF certification being standard and companies offering integrated supply chain support for Tier 1 and 2 suppliers. The Portland/Pacific Northwest region features companies emphasizing engineering services and sustainable manufacturing practices, with strong ISO certification standards and diversified industry portfolios.

Several companies in the Boston area are located in smaller surrounding communities (Gardner, Fitchburg, Pittsfield) rather than Boston proper, reflecting the historical distribution of manufacturing in New England. Detroit-area companies similarly extend throughout the metro region into Plymouth, Chesterfield, and Imlay City. The Portland search yielded strong results from the broader metro area including Clackamas, Vancouver (WA), and Wilsonville.
